Firewalls and Intrusion Detection Systems
Firewalls and intrusion detection systems are essential for cybersecurity. They act as barriers against unauthorized access to networks. He must understand that firewalls filter incoming and outgoing traffic. This filtering helps prevent potential threats.
Intrusion detection systems monitor network activity for suspicious behavior. They provide alerts when anomalies are detected. Quick responses can mitigate potential damage.

Encryption Techniques for Data Protection
Encryption techniques are vital for data protection. They convert sensitive information into unreadable formats. He must recognize that strong encryption safeguards financial data. This protection is essential against unauthorized access.
Common methods include symmetric and asymmetric encryption. Symmetric encryption uses a single key, while asymmetric employs a public-private key pair. Both methods enhance security significantly.

Blockchain Technology and Its Security Benefits
Blockchain technology offers significant security benefits. It operates on a decentralized network, reducing single points of failure. This structure enhances resilience against cyber attacks. He should understand that data is stored in blocks. Each block is linked to the previous one, creating an immutable chain.
Additionally, blockchain employs cryptographic techniques for data integrity. This ensures that once data is recorded, it cannot be altered. Compliance Standards for Cryptocurrency Exchanges
Compliance standards for cryptocurrency exchanges are critical for legitimacy. They ensure that exchanges adhere to anti-money laundering (AML) and know your customer (KYC) regulations. He lust implement these standards to prevent illicit activities. Non-compliance can result in severe penalties and loss of reputation.
Additionally, regulatory bodies require regular audits and reporting. These measures enhance transparency and build trust with users. Statistics show that compliant exchanges attract more investors.
